In a new study published by Elsevier Energy #GIST researchers propose a novel #Iridium #nanostructure supported on mesoporous tantalum oxide for catalyzing #OxygenEvolutionReaction for #HydrogenProduction. Read more: ow.ly/5yB250PwjOt



#GIST researchers develop an adversarial task adaptive pretraining approach for #VoicePathologyDetection, circumventing the problem of #overfitting and leading to better #performance than existing alternatives. Read more in the IEEE Signal Processing Society journal: ow.ly/KJ1i50PUTPM




A recent Applied Catalysis B study by #GIST researchers presents a novel #SchottkyJunction #electrode that #catalyzes #WaterSplitting reactions for #green #hydrogen production. Read more here: ow.ly/w9NU50Q4S1g




A recent Nature Communications study by #GIST researchers examines the #correlation between #MolecularOrientation and peculiar #transient #behaviors of #organic #electrochemical devices, leading to #bioelectronics and #BioFuelCell applications. More here: ow.ly/VLPk50QrYBZ



Scientists from #GIST, in a Nature Communications study, discover a new peripheral 5HT2A antagonist molecule, which holds immense promise in treating #MASLD and reducing #liverfibrosis, with phase 1 #clinicaltrials underway. Read more: ow.ly/PyBR50R5yvl


A new npj Journals research study by #GIST researchers sheds light on the link between #ClimateChange and #ExtremeWeather in #WesternNorthAmerica, revealing a complex interplay influenced by #GreenhouseGasEmissions. Read more: ow.ly/nw4a50R7aEH






#GIST researchers developed, in a Chemical Engineering Journal study, a novel #NitrogenDoped #MesoporousCarbon coated #GraphiteFeltElectrode, which suppresses #SelfDischarge in #FlowlessZincBromineBatteries, significantly improving #performance and lifespan. Read more: ow.ly/SMBh50SCW1q


A Nature Communications study by GIST(Gwangju Institute of Science & Technology) researchers presented novel defect #passivation #strategy for improving #power conversion #efficiency and #stability of polycrystalline #perovskite of #SolarCells. Read more: ow.ly/f2Zm50Th5XM


Scientists from #GIST have created a monocular vision system inspired by feline eyes. With a slit-like aperture & patterned reflector, it enhances object detection and filters out redundant information in challenging lighting. Read more Science Advances: ow.ly/vF9T50TJoWs


GIST(Gwangju Institute of Science & Technology) #researchers introduced a new #dataset TimelyTale that includes #environmental, driving-related, and passenger-specific #data for generating timely and context-specific #explanations to #AutomatedVehicle decisions Read more: ow.ly/ZhTf50U10b7
